Judith Lieb is an acting justice of the Bronx County Supreme Court, Criminal Term in the 12th Judicial District of New York. She was appointed to this position in 2004. She also served as a judge of the New York City Criminal Court of Bronx County since 2005.[1][2]

Education

Lieb received her B.A. degree from Yale University in 1982 and her J.D. degree from Michigan Law School in 1986.[1]

Career

Lieb began her career in 1986 as a judicial clerk for Judge Betty Binns Fletcher of the United States Court of Appeals for the 9th Circuit. In 1988, she joined the law firm of Paul, Weiss, Rifkind, Wharton & Garrison as a litigation associate. She then worked as an Assistant U.S. Attorney for the Eastern District of New York from 1991 until her judicial appointment in 1999.

Lieb was appointed an Interim Civil Court Judge assigned to the New York City Criminal Court of Bronx County in 1999. She was reappointed to this position every year thereafter until 2005, when she was appointed to a full term as Judge of the New York City Criminal Court, Bronx County. She has also served as an Acting Supreme Court Justice since 2004.[1]
